.NET Micro Framework for Linux
Development
The .NET Micro Framework for Linux is a small, free and open-source platform by Microsoft that allows writing .NET applications for resource-constrained devices running Linux. It includes a small version of the .NET runtime and libraries.

Kentucky Route Zero
Games
Kentucky Route Zero is an episodic point-and-click adventure game developed by Cardboard Computer. The game tells the story of a secret highway in Kentucky and the mysterious characters who travel it.
